Affiliation granted for imparting education is not exempt

November 17, 2022 2277 Views 0 comment Print

Affiliation granted to colleges for imparting education is not exempt  vide entry No.66 of notfn No.12/2017-CT(R) dated 28.6.2017 and Affiliation in relation to a college is an activity to recognize such college to the privileges of the university to which the institution is affiliated.

Margin Scheme in GST- All You wanted to Know

November 16, 2022 20076 Views 3 comments Print

Normally GST is charged on the transaction value of the goods. However, in respect of second hand goods, a person dealing in such goods may be allowed to pay tax on the margin i.e. the difference between the value at which the goods are supplied and the price at which the goods are purchased. If there is no margin, no GST is charged for such supply.

Omission/ error in GSTR-1 cannot be rectified beyond period prescribed u/s 39(9) of CGST Act

November 16, 2022 9558 Views 0 comment Print

Telengana High Court held that statute has introduced limitation under section 39(9) of the Central Goods and Services Tax Act, 2017 to rectify omission/ error in GSTR-1 return and accordingly assessee cannot be permitted to carry out rectification beyond the statutorily prescribed period.
